The first look is SUPER quick and easy. Curl the hair, tease the crown, and put on a cute glitzy headband. Voila, festive hair-do!

With this look I braided a loose braid on each side of my head, then raked all my hair back with my fingers and paddle brush into a messy bun. The curls help to create more texture with the low bun. This will be perfect for my Ugly Sweater Christmas party where I'll be running around putting up last minute decor and busy hosting. My hair is pulled out of my face but still looks cute and put together!


I have short side-swept bangs which means my braids need a lot of hairspray! I did a french braid until the back of my head and a wrapped pony to cover the elastic, then teased my pony to help the loose curls look thicker.
